Antiviral Tfh response by “tolerant” congenitally infected virus carriers drives antibody-mediated viral load control [scRNA-Seq]

GSE272558 Mus musculus Expression profiling by high throughput sequencing 8 samples Submitted 2026/03/30 Platform GPL24247
Summary
Congenital infection can result in viral persistence as commonly observed for hepatitis B virus in humans. The accompanying “neonatal tolerance” state remains immunologically ill-defined and treatment options are unsatisfactory. Studying congenital lymphocytic choriomeningitis virus infection, the prototypic mouse model of neonatal antiviral tolerance, we observe antibody-mediated suppression of viral replication. These responses are driven by canonical antiviral CD4 Tfh responses, whereas CD8 T cells are irrelevant for viral load control. Viral epitope-specific CD4 T cells of congenitally infected animals are less abundant than in adult infection. They exhibit reduced clonal diversity and distinct differences in gene expression patterns. Importantly, exogenous supplementation of T help augments antiviral germinal center B responses of congenitally infected mice. These findings reveal that humoral immune defense is partially exempt from neonatal tolerance and remains effective against congenital infection. Imperfect virus control by limited CD4 Tfh responses may offer opportunities for a functional cure by immunotherapy.
